Social media is a powerful tool to grow your business and connect with your audience. But with so many different types of content you can share, it can be hard to know where to start. The key is to focus on content that will grab attention, engage your followers, and encourage them to take action. In this blog, we’ll explore the four most effective types of content you should be sharing on social media to boost your marketing strategy.
1. Informative and Educational Content
People are always looking to learn something new. Whether it’s a quick tip, a helpful how-to guide, or an industry trend, sharing educational content positions you as an expert in your field.
You could share:
Tips and Tricks: Simple advice that makes your audience’s lives easier.
How-To Guides: Step-by-step instructions that solve common problems.
Infographics: Visual content that explains complex information in a simple way.
Why it works: People value learning, and when they see you offering valuable information, they’re more likely to follow you for more.
2. Behind-the-Scenes Content
Show your audience the human side of your brand. Behind-the-scenes content makes your business feel more real and relatable. It could be anything from a photo of your workspace to a video showing how your product is made or the daily life of your team.
You could share:
Workplace Moments: A sneak peek into your daily routine or team collaboration.
Product Creation: How your products or services come to life.
Team Stories: Introduce your team members and share what they do.
Why it works: People love to connect with brands on a personal level, and behind-the-scenes content gives them a glimpse into your company culture.
3. User-Generated Content (UGC)
When your customers share their experiences with your product or service, it’s gold. User-generated content (UGC) is any content your audience creates and shares online. It could be a photo, review, or video. UGC builds trust because it shows real people using and enjoying your product.
You could share:
Customer Photos: Encourage customers to share images of them using your product.
Testimonials: Post positive feedback from your happy customers.
Reposts: Share posts from your customers tagging your brand.
Why it works: UGC acts as social proof, showing potential customers that real people trust and enjoy your brand.
4. Interactive Content
Interactive content is a fun way to engage your followers and get them involved. It encourages them to participate, share their opinions, and even have some fun. This type of content can help create conversations, build relationships, and keep your audience engaged for longer.
You could share:
Polls and Quizzes: Let your audience share their opinions or test their knowledge.
Contests and Giveaways: Offer something valuable in exchange for engagement.
Ask Questions: Encourage your audience to share their thoughts in the comments.
Why it works: Interactive content boosts engagement by making your followers feel involved and heard, which helps strengthen your connection with them.
Social media marketing is all about creating meaningful connections with your audience. By sharing informative, behind-the-scenes, user-generated, and interactive content, you’ll not only keep your followers engaged, but also build trust and loyalty. Focus on these types of content, and you’ll see your social media strategy grow.
